For my birthday this year I finally made this dress wearable again!
I made this dress a couple years ago and accidentally made the elastics at the waist too tight (which made the dress very uncomfortable to wear). I sometimes really dread alterations and keep procrastinating on them for no real reason.
I only removed the elastics from the waist part and haven't added new (less tight) ones yet. The dress is already wearable as is, though I noticed another problem: I didn't have lots of fabric when I made this dress and the patchwork bodice is a bit shorter than usual for this pattern. So now this annoys me and I think about elongating the bodice somehow... sigh... would be a lot of work though!

Stands on Soapbox and Yells at Cloud
There's a post that's been hanging out in a ship tag I follow that has been getting under my skin for a day now. It was a post basically stating that "they would like a ship more if there was less (insert whatever) in the fandom." And, I was going to try and keep ignoring it, but it's just there, and I have to keep looking at it. So, y'all have to hear me complain about it.
So, here is my unbridled response:
If you aren't finding the fan content you like in a fandom or ship, then make it yourself.
I mean this with a degree of gentleness and a degree of harsh reality. Creators aren't here to bend to your whim because you don't like some of the things you see, or because you feel like there is too much of one thing in a fandom, or even if you feel like there isn't enough content that caters specifically to your identity or tastes or desires. If you're not finding what you want - make it yourself.
"But I can't draw/write/create!"
Bullshit. No one starts out perfect, expect that without a shadow of a doubt, but you are going to be creating something that you enjoy. You are creating something specifically for you. You are creating the content you want to see in a fandom. You are engaging in a way that is meaningful to you, and that is what is important. Skill will come with time and practice.
Don't be upset because your specific wants aren't being met in a fandom. Don't throw an entire group of creators under the bus because you aren't seeing what you want to see. Get around and do something about it so your wants are represented - by you.
Because, fan content isn't created for you, it's shared with you.

DIY Strawberry Shiratama Dango
Strawberry Shiratama Dango is a dessert often made during the spring to celebrate Hinamatsuri (Girls day). This traditional Japanese dessert recipe is soft, chewy and easy to make!

I have recently been converted to the coffee lover cult. In order to not break my wallet buying coffee everyday, I got the stuff to make it myself!
And I mean I got the least fancy coffee stuff I could get: the biggest containers of instant coffee and hot cocoa mix I could find at Sam's club.
I don't even have creamer, just milk and sugar. And sometimes not even milk. However, the iced coffee I made for myself this morning was absolutely delicious.
I love being able to control the ingredient amounts so its the right level of caffinated and sweet.
My PSA for today: you don't need anything fancy to make good coffee. You don't need to shovel money to coffee shops like Starbucks to get your fix. Sometimes the simple and cheap option does work.
